Index | Thread | Search

From:
Mikolaj Kucharski <mikolaj@kucharski.name>
Subject:
Re: Leftover /var/lib reported by sysclean(8)
To:
ports@openbsd.org
Date:
Thu, 28 Aug 2025 10:53:24 +0000

Download raw body.

Thread
On Thu, Aug 28, 2025 at 10:51:10AM +0000, Mikolaj Kucharski wrote:
> On Thu, Aug 28, 2025 at 11:45:51AM +0100, Stuart Henderson wrote:
> > On 2025/08/28 10:34, Mikolaj Kucharski wrote:
> > > Hi.
> > > 
> > > I think some package has `/var/lib` missing in their PLIST.
> > > 
> > > # sysclean | grep -F /var/lib
> > > /var/lib
> > > 
> > > # find /var/lib/ -ls
> > >  51840    4 drwxr-xr-x    3 root     wheel         512 Jun 26 12:27 /var/lib/
> > >  51841    4 drwxr-x---    2 root     wheel         512 Jun 26 12:27 /var/lib/letsencrypt
> > > 
> > > Not sure should that be part of certbot package:
> > > 
> > > # pkglocate /var/lib/letsencrypt
> > > certbot-4.1.1:security/letsencrypt/client:/var/lib/letsencrypt/
> > > 
> > > Is it just adding /var/lib to certbot PLIST file?
> > > 
> > 
> > Since r1.1 of Makefile there's a sed to use /var/db/letsencrypt instead
> > of /var/lib, so I've changed it to @sample /var/db/letsencrypt.
> > 
> 
> I am removing this directory and it comes back to my machine. I see this
> problem for months.
> 
> # grep -F /var/lib/letsencrypt /var/db/pkg/certbot-4.1.1/+CONTENTS
> @sample /var/lib/letsencrypt/
> 

Ah, I see it now. You just fixed it. Thanks!

-- 
Regards,
 Mikolaj